    Honestly I think ESO looks very, very impressive for its age and given that its intended to run on some pretty low configs / old consoles stably.

    So I think the direction they've taken, of adding new technologies as options as they become available and upping the resolution of objects in new zones a bit, is a sensible one.

    Realistically, I think a full remaster to higher res textures across the board is probably unrealistic given the size of the game. It would take a MASSIVE amount of work unless everything existed at the time the game was made in a much higher fidelity version (in which case it would be a case of substituting objects that already exist -- still a lot of work but not a total re-do). The game is absolutely huge and you'd need a lot of players to justify that.

    world of warcraft updated a bunch of their base game zones when the game was 6 years old and on it's 3rd expansion. the devs eventually stated it was a waste of time money and effort which detracted from making content for the expansion it went live in. if zos did do some sort of visual upgrade i hope they look at blizzard's mistakes and are careful to avoid starving the game for the sake of aesthetics. considering there will be no further dlc after necrom launch, i am not confident they have the resources to accomplish anything but the bare minimum we are already getting.
